How do I choose the best alternative to Pi(Presentation Intelligence)?
Start with your must‑have features and workflows. Check integration coverage (APIs, webhooks, SSO), privacy/compliance certifications (GDPR, SOC 2), and data handling policies. Run a pilot with 2–3 candidates against real tasks to validate usability, output quality, and latency before committing.
How should I compare pricing across Pi(Presentation Intelligence) alternatives?
Normalize pricing to your actual usage: count seats, API calls, storage, compute limits, and potential overages. Factor in hidden costs like setup fees, migration support, training, premium support tiers, and data retention policies. Review rate limits and fair‑use clauses to avoid surprises at scale.
Are there free alternatives to Pi(Presentation Intelligence)?
Yes—many alternatives offer free tiers or extended trials. Carefully review limits: API quotas, throughput caps, export restrictions, feature gating, watermarks, and data retention. Ensure the free tier matches your real workload and provides clear, fair upgrade paths without lock‑in.
What should I look for when switching from Pi(Presentation Intelligence)?
Prioritize migration ease: data export completeness, API parity, bulk import tools, and onboarding support quality. Verify that integrations, SSO, and admin controls match or exceed your current setup. Check vendor lock‑in risks and contractual exit clauses before committing.
